Gas Hobs
In any modern kitchen, a good hob is a must. No matter if you prefer gas, induction or ceramic, there's an appliance that will fit your style and budget. A quality hob will heat quickly ovens and hobs uk evenly which allows you to cook food in no time. It also adds a sleek finish to the kitchen.
One of the main advantages of a gas hob is the precise temperature control. It is quick to reach temperatures that are high making it ideal for searing meat, boiling water and stir-frying vegetables. Its ability adjust temperature quickly makes it ideal for delicate sauces or dishes that require low temperatures.
Another benefit of a gas hob is its energy efficiency. It makes use of natural gas, which is generally less expensive than electricity, making it less expensive to run a stove. It also makes use of a direct flame for heating your utensils. This means there is less energy lost around the edges of the burner.
Modern gas hobs have modern designs that will complement any kitchen decor. You can find models with a shiny black or stainless steel finishes that blend in seamlessly and hob Uk make your kitchen appear more contemporary. You can also select models made of glass which is easy to clean and extremely durable.
Gas hobs have become the most popular choice in modern kitchens because of their flexibility and simplicity of use. They can also complement traditional kitchen designs, particularly when you incorporate a range cooker into the layout. But, it is important to note that they could increase the risk of fire when compared with electric or induction hobs. They don't have safety features, such as being able to switch off instantly and having child-safety locks on the knobs for control.
When selecting a gas stove, be aware of the number of cooking zones and burners you require. You can select models with either 1, 2 or 5 cooking zones. A majority of models feature a central wok that is a very powerful burner that can be used for rapid boiling or stir-frying. You should also check the kind of ignition system that is used. Most gas hobs light the burners using an electric spark or a constant electric pilot flame.
Hobs induction
While gas hobs are still a popular choice for home cooks, induction cookers are gaining popularity for their speed and efficiency. These flat glass-topped cookers employ magnetism to heat the contents of a pan rather than heating the surface, which makes them more efficient and also safer since there is no flame under. Induction hobs come with a range of features. Our Good Housekeeping Institute experts found that certain features can be very useful.
One of them is the bridge function, which allows you to join two hob rings in order to make room for larger pans. You can also choose to regulate the temperature of each ring individually by using the touchscreen panel. This is an excellent option for those who love to entertain and can be a lifesaver when there are guests who have different dietary requirements. It is important to note that induction hobs aren't suitable for people who wear pacemakers since they create electromagnetic fields that could interfere with their function.
The British Heart Foundation recommends that you keep a distance of least 60cm between any source of power and an active hob, especially if you're wearing a pacemaker. The word hob is a traditional English term, originally meaning "a grate or shelf by a flame'. It's an old-fashioned term that refers to the way we cooked at home many years ago, with massive fireplaces and separate shelves where pots were set to cook. Nowadays, kitchens are equipped with an oven and a separate hob (stove top) which is either gas or electric.
The British often refer to their stove as a hob however other countries might use the term cooker. A hob is an individual appliance that comes with heating rings for saucepans. A cooker is a larger unit that combines a hob with an oven. A range cooker is a combination of oven and hob which are usually incorporated into one large unit.
